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

The invention is directed to a process for the preparation of a reinforced article which comprises the step of molding a molding composition comprising pellets into the article at an elevated temperature, wherein each of the pellets has an axial length and comprises a core and a sheath around the core, wherein the core comprises an impregnating agent and a multifilament strand comprising glass fibers each having a length substantially equal to the axial length of the pellet and substantially oriented in the axial length of the pellet, wherein the sheath comprises a thermoplastic polymer; and wherein the molding composition further comprises a filler.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

The invention claimed is: 1. A process for the preparation of a reinforced article comprising: molding a molding composition comprising pellets into the article at an elevated temperature, wherein the elevated temperature is a temperature at which the molding composition has enough flowability to be molded, wherein each of the pellets has an axial length and comprises a core extending along the axial length and a sheath around the core, wherein the core comprises an impregnating agent and a multifilament strand comprising glass fibers each having a length substantially equal to the axial length of the pellet and substantially oriented in the axial length of the pellet, wherein the amount of glass fibers in the multifilament strand is 30-50 wt % based on the weight of the molding composition, wherein the sheath comprises a thermoplastic polymer, wherein the thermoplastic polymer is a propylene homopolymer or a propylene copolymer; and wherein the molding composition further comprises a filler and wherein the molded composition has an isotropic E-modulus of at least 5000 MPa as determined according to ISO527/1B at 23° C. 2. The process according to claim 1 , wherein the filler is present in the sheath of the pellet. 3. The process according to claim 1 , wherein the filler comprises talc particles or glass fibers. 4. The process according to claim 1 , wherein the molding step involves injection molding. 5. The process according to claim 1 , wherein the molding composition comprises 0.5-25 wt % of the filler based on the weight of the molding composition. 6. The process according to claim 1 , wherein the amount of filler is 1-20 wt % based on the weight of the molding composition. 7. An article obtainable by the process according to claim 1 . 8. The article of claim 7 , wherein the article is an automotive part. 9. The process of claim 1 , wherein the isotropic E-modulus is at least 6000 MPa as determined according to ISO527/1B at 23° C. 10. The process of claim 1 , wherein the viscosity of the impregnating agent is less than 100 Centistokes. 11. The process of claim 1 , wherein the impregnating agent is present in an amount of 0.05 to 6 weight percent based on the total weight of the molding composition. 12. The process of claim 1 , wherein the elevated temperature is above the melting point of the thermoplastic polymer that is present in the sheath of the pellets. 13. The process of claim 1 , wherein the elevated temperature is 150-500° C.
